Trailer Hitch, Wiring and Accessories to Tow a Pop-up Camper Trailer with a 2002 Toyota Sequoia  

Question:

I want to purchase a hitch for a pop up camper. I have a 2002 Toyota Sequoia.

Expert Reply:

I will be happy to set you up with everything you will need to tow a trailer with your 2002 Toyota Sequoia. First, you will need a trailer hitch. I have included a link to the trailer hitches that we offer for your vehicle. The most popular option is Draw-Tite trailer hitch # 75126.

This is a Class III hitch with a 2 inch receiver. The 2 inch receiver has the widest range of accessory options. It also has a tongue weight capacity of 500 pounds and a gross trailer weight capacity of 5,000 pounds. Be sure to consult your vehicle owners manual to determine the towing capacities of the vehicle.

This hitch can also be used with weight distribution which basically distributes the tongue weight of the trailer more evenly across all axles of both the tow vehicle and trailer. With a pop-up camper, you probably will not need weight distribution but should you tow something heavier later, it is something to think about.

Next you will need some towing accessories. I recommend the etrailer ball mount kit # 989900. It comes with 2 ball mounts, 2 balls, a hitch pin with clip, and a storage bag. And if the Sequoia does not already have some sort of trailer wiring harness to plug the trailer into then you can use # C55246.

The pop-up camper may or may not have a 4-Way flat like on the harness listed above. But, not to worry, there are many different adapters available. I would just need to know what type of connector the trailer has. I have included a link to our adapter main page.
